Abstract
A method for dehydrating aluminum chloride hexahydrate which comprises contacting the hexahydrate with a melt consisting essentially of a chlorobasic mixture of aluminum chloride and alkali metal chloride and then treating the resulting mixture with HCl to form an AlCl.sub.3 /alkali metal chloride melt enriched in AlCl.sub.3. NaCl is a preferred alkali metal chloride.
